Default Rear Main Seal

is leaking. how hard is it to get to? looks like the torque tube would have to come out. would that be a bear getting out?

thanks, Steve

you will need to lower the rear cradle and remove the drivetrain and flywheel. be sure it's not the oil pressure sensor leaking first.

The rear main seldom leake but,,, thats not saying that they dont! You have to remove the ENTIRE DRIVETRAIN to get to the rear main.

Like SaberD stated, i would go out of my way to make sure that it not coming from the oil sender or the cam sensor.

Wash everything down with brake parts cleaner and get a mirror back there and look with a nice bright light.

yes changed sender last week. ran it a day with oil dye. took the inspect boot off where the ring gear is and it looks like it is leaking there. but there is oil all over the pan after driving it awhile (40-50mi.) I get about 3-5 drops of oil in about 1 1/2 hr.
the car is a 2002 coupe a/t 106,500 mi.

Brake parts cleaner is inexpensive. Wash down the inside of the bell housing and get rid of all the oil and dirt and let it all eveporate. Then see if you can figure out where the oils is coming from while its running.
